My second daughter was due on the 29th November 2012. I had gestational hypertension in my previous pregnancy and ended up being induced at 38w, I was determined to have a natural onset to labour this time but my BP started to rise around 35w this time and I had to be admitted to hospital for monitoring on a couple of occasions and I really did think I'd end up being induced again. Luckily my BP returned back to a normal or a much lower range and so I was allowed to go home but my appointments were made weekly for my BP to keep being checked just incase. I reached 39w and was so pleased that I'd made it that far but then also very eager to get things going incase I ended up going over and then having to be induced because of that!
I had a sweep booked in with my consultant at my 40w appt on Mon 26th (I was 39+4) and was really nervous about it. I didn't want it to hurt but I was also scared it wouldn't work and I'd be pregnant forever! The sweep was absolutely fine and didn't hurt at all and I was pleased to find out I was already 1-2cms dilated but my cervix was still very thick and long but the consultant had managed to do the sweep so it was now just a waiting game. I was booked back in for a sweep on my EDD and then if that was unsuccessful and induction for Mon 3rd Dec.
I got home that evening and thought I'd see if I could help the sweep along. I'd had a bit of backache but that died down to nothing so I bounced on my ball for around an hour or so whilst watching TV and moaning to my OH about how I wasn't feeling a thing, the sweep was unsuccessful, I was still going to be pregnant in a fortnight etc etc
you know how it is! I got bored of bouncing so got up to go to the loo and make a drink. That's when I noticed small parts of my plug had started to come away
I was immediately excited and even ran in to my OH's bathroom to show him! Gross, I know! I got back on that ball and bounced for a further hour whilst sniffing clary sage oil straight out of the aromatherapy bottle. Thought I may as well try everything now, so also did a bit of nipple stimulation too.
We went to bed at around 11pm on Monday night and I fell asleep instantly. I had a pretty good night's sleep but I remember dreaming I was having contractions, it was so strange. At 5.03am I was awoken by a very sharp tightening that started in my lower back and spread across to the bottom of my bump. It wasn't very painful but definitely wasn't a BH either. I was still half asleep but thought I better stay awake incase another one strikes and I need to get my contraction timer app on the go. I started to get my hopes up but also thought I better keep level headed as this may result in nothing. Sure enough, 8 mins later another contraction hit. Again I didn't want to jump ahead with the timer but thought I'll keep my eye on it. Another contraction hit around 8-10mins later. Suddenly I had an almighty need to go to the loo for a ''clear out''. I got up, went to the loo and started timing the contractions. I went in to the front room, watched the TV and started to bounce on my ball some more. The contractions were coming regularly between every 4-10mins and lasting for around 30-50secs. They still weren't very painful still but I think after 50mins or so I started to believe they were the real deal as they were definitely becoming more intense. I went to the toilet again for another clear out and that's when I had my bloody show. I decided to ring L&D just for some info as I was unsure of what to do. My previous labour had been induced so I never got the natural onset and slow build up of contractions. That labour was also under 4 hours long and I was worried I'd have another quick labour and we wouldn't make it to the hospital! The MW I spoke to told me it sounded like early labour and to just continue to time then, once the contractions were so bad I couldn't talk through them anymore it'd be time to go in and get checked.
I bounced on my ball some more and eventually woke my OH up at 7am to tell him I'd been contracting for the past 2hrs. He immediately got up and suggested we get ready, get DD up and dressed and go to the in-law's. They were to take care of DD and the hospital is 10mins from their house. I thought it was too early and didn't particularly want to be contracting badly in front of his mum
but it did make sense, so we all got ready, loaded the hospital bags in the car and set off at around 7.30. OH decided to give the M25 a miss and go the M1 and back roads (we were heading in to NW London) and sure enough we got stuck in rush hour traffic
the car journey increased my contractions, and we made it to MIL's at around 8.45am. My contractions were a lot stronger but I could still talk through them and they were still anywhere between 5-7mins lasting 40-53 secs. Oh & I took a walk around the local park and this seemed to help me contract more, so half an hour later we headed back to the in-law's and OH ran me a bath as the contractions were getting sharper. I sat in the bath for around 30mins and my contractions started coming every 5 mins lasting for 50sec-1min+ so I decided it was time to go in to L&D, even though I could still talk through the contractions.
When we got there luckily it wasn't too busy so the MW agreed to take me in to a delivery suite and check my progress. I was only 2cms and a little bit disappointed but then all of a sudden I started getting lower back ache that was a million times more painful with each contraction. I was pretty much screaming through them
they were coming every couple of mins, and each time I would throw myself on the floor in a crouch or crawl position to help with the pain. In hindsight, I don't actually think this helped lessen the pain but at the time it seemed to be the right thing to do! The MW asked me if I'd like some pethidine but I declined as I had it in my last labour and didn't like it very much.
Just 30 mins later and I was still screaming (or wailing as my OH would tell you!) with each contraction and had accepted some paracetomol that had not helped at all. The MW checked baby's position and said she thought she was laying back to back which would explain the excruciating backache I had. The back pains were so much more worse than the contractions
I begged for her to do another internal as I was sure I had to be more than 2cms but she wasn't keen - she wanted to wait 2hrs+ between each examination. She finally agreed and I was very pleased to hear I was 4-5cms. She asked me if I wanted an epidural to help with the pain and I eagerly accepted the offer. I had originally only wanted to birth with G&A this time but I also hadn't expected to be in so much pain with the baby being back to back, so anything I could do to regain control of myself and the situation I was more than happy to do! An anaesthetist was available straight away so he came in, gave me the chat about the risks/effects etc and then they set to work. I forgot to say I was on G&A up to this point, but it really wasn't helping - especially not for the backache. The anaesthetist asked where the back pain was and I pointed out the area which hurt the most and he agreed baby was back to back and pressing on my spine and nerves, so he also offered me a spinal as he said the epi probably wouldn't take the back pains away. I couldn't have agreed more to anything in my life I don't think
It was all set up and the spinal instantly started to work, but the anaesthetist explained he had slightly missed the pidural space and the needle was sited in some blood vessels
he said it still might work but there was no guarantee and the chances were low. He explained that he could take it out and try again but for some reason the chances of getting it sited correctly were now lower because of him missing it the first time
I was already in a lot less pain so said I would see how this one went and get it resited if needs be.
From here on in things became a bit boring! I was no longer in pain, but wasn't able to move about as I was on the CTG monitor, blood pressure cuff, IV in hand, catheter fitted etc so I just sat on the bed laughing and joking with my OH, the MW, and also the paramedic who was getting some experience on births and the trainee doctor who had asked if they could be there during my labour/birth. The spinal ran out after 1.5hrs and the backache started to creep back but I had the epi topped up and it seemed to be working, although not as efficiently as it was supposed to. I quite liked that though as I was still in pain but it was definitely bearable and I was able to enjoy the whole experience.
I felt a lot of pressure by 4pm and told the MW I needed to be examined and she agreed to. I was now 8cms and she broke my waters for me. The contractions became a lot more frequent and stronger and I kept asking and asking to be checked but she refused to do so until 5.25pm
I told her I was needing to push but she told me to puff on the G&A each time I felt the urge and it would help me to stop pushing! I should also add that after my internal at 5.25pm I wouldn't be allowed to push for a further hour, as with the epi they make you wait for the baby to descend down the birth canal. I knew there was no way that was going to happen as I was needing to push for ages! 5.25 FINALLY came round and she did my internal for me. The look on her face was priceless... she told me to give a little push which I did and she said ''right, time to push this baby out!'' HA, told you so
she quickly got her apron and gloves on, put the pads down and got all the equipment ready for baby's arrival. I was sat right up on the bed and my feet were put on the pushing paddle things and some bars were raised up on the sides of the bed for me to pull.
It was now 5.30pm and a contraction came and I started pushing immediately. I had previously joked with the paramedic guy and the trainee doctor that I wanted this baby out in 5 mins
I had pushed DD out in 13mins and said I wanted to beat my last time! They all laughed along and must've been thinking ''yeh alright love!''. I pushed and pushed and the MW then told me to just breathe and do small, tiny pushes and out came my beautiful girl's head
OH just kept saying over and over ''she's got hair, she's got hair!'' He was great, cheering me on throughout and giving me little pep talks
with another contraction and a push and out popped her whole body. It was just amazing. I didn't truly feel my DD1 come out last time as the previous epi was pretty effective and I only felt the contractions enough to get the urge to push. This time round I felt DD2 crowning, which felt very surreal and strange but thankfully didn't sting! And her body literally just slithered out. The time was 5.35pm - exactly 5 mins pushing ![Very Happy :D :D](/styles/default/xenforo/smilies/icon_biggrin.gif)
She was put on my chest and we left her cord to stop pulsating before it was clamped and OH cut it. She was then put under my shirt for skin to skin and I was just on cloud 9. Lots of pics were taken, everybody congratulating me, OH kissing DD and me telling me how amazing I had been and he couldn't believe it etc. Equally as amazing as DD1's birth, so the best time of my life all over again
I put her straight to the breast and she suckled for a long while so we didn't know her weight for a while. Eventually she came off and they weighed her and OH got her dressed whilst I was seen by the MW to have my catheter removed. I also had a small cut inside of my vagina so that was stitched up and I felt great. Baby weighed 3.520kg (7lbs 12oz), OH had a lovely hold of his newest daughter and she was then returned to me to be fed.
The 3 of us were left for a good few hours to bond and I was then taken up to the postnatal ward at 10pm and OH had to leave
I was shattered though so thought I'd just get some sleep and then he'd be back with DD1 to see us in the morning. I was pleasantly surprised to be given my own room, it was lovely to not be in a room with 3 other new mum's and all the crying babies. I just got to rest, kiss and cuddle my little lady and just relax. She slept soundly, I on the otherhand was still on a natural high from the birth and I couldn't shut off. I just watched her sleep, texted friends and family and ended up getting around 2 hours sleep. Oooops!
We were allowed home the next day (wednesday) and it's now Friday, our newest baby now has a name - Millie Emma, she's 3 days old and everything is going great. We are breastfeeding and she's taken to it amazingly. I failed BF'ing with DD1 so am determined to make it work this time and am over the moon with how it's going so far. Millie is doing great, she's so good and quiet it's almost as if she isn't here sometimes!! DD1 Amber loves her little sis to bits
seeing them together melts my heart. Millie is the absolute spit of her sis as a newborn and I can't wait to see if she'll continue to grow and look like her or change completely. OH is just amazing, but I never doubted he'd be anything less. He was superb through DD1's birth and bringing her home and he hasn't failed to amaze me again
he wakes with me for each feed at night, even though he doesn't need to! He'll get Millie from her basket for me, do the nappy changes and put her back so I literally just have to sit up, get a boob out, feed and then lie myself back down
it's not a bad deal really!
